Abstract
An absorbent article having opposite longitudinally extending sides and opposite laterally extending ends extending between the longitudinally extending sides is provided. The absorbent article includes a chassis including a topsheet and a backsheet joined to the topsheet. The chassis has a front waist region, a back waist region, a crotch region located between the front waist region and the back waist region, a longitudinal axis extending through the front and back waist regions and a lateral axis substantially perpendicular to the longitudinal axis. A barrier cuff strip extends in a longitudinal direction from the front waist region to the back waist region along the topsheet. The barrier cuff strip includes a front end at the front waist region, a back end at the back waist region and proximal and distal edges connecting the front end and the back end. The barrier cuff strip distal edge is attached to the topsheet at a cuff end bond region that has an outer bond edge at one of the front and back waist regions and an inner bond edge spaced longitudinally from the outer bond edge. An absorbent core is disposed between the topsheet and the backsheet. The absorbent core includes an absorbent layer including an absorbent material comprising a superabsorbent polymer material wherein at least about 60 percent by weight of the absorbent material is the superabsorbent polymer material. A longitudinal distance from the inner bond edge to the laterally extending side at the one of the front and back waist regions is about ½ or more of a longitudinal length of the one of the front and back waist regions.
